  1. The Adventures of Don Quick is a science fiction comedy television series that ran from October–December 1970, on ITV. Starring Ian Hendry and Ronald Lacey, six 50 minute episodes were made, shown in a 60-minute time slot.

  2. Broadcast by ITV at 9pm on Friday nights, 'The Adventures Of Don Quick' was a lightly satirical comedy that often addressed the changing social values of the increasingly more liberal 1960s and 1970s. It had a science fiction setting but obviously tipped its hat to Cervantes.

  3. Based on the characters from Don Quixote, astronauts Captain Don Quick and Sergeant Sam Czopanser, are members of the "Intergalactic Maintenance Squad", visiting various planets and attempting to solve any local problems...

  5. 4 mag 2023 · The Adventures Of Don Quick was a science fiction satire based on the characters of Don Quixote. It was produced by London Weekend Television for six 1 hour episodes (including ad breaks) in 1970. Money had been spent on the sets, as an impressive thirty-foot model spaceship was built in the studio for the series.

  7. 26 nov 2018 · Like Quixote, Captain Don Quick has his trusty Sancho Panza in the form of Sergeant Sam Czopanser (Ronald Lacey). A 30 foot model spaceship was built for the series but in spite of the effort that went into it The Adventures of Don Quick failed to win over an audience and after just three episodes was consigned to a late-night time slot before disappearing quicker than a shooting star.
